… I'm a teacher from Malaysia. I need to find out numbers between the range 3140 to 4140 whose sum should be 21. The generic age calculation formulas discussed above work great in most cases. Incredible product, even better tech support…AbleBits totally delivers! Good work. My Database only exports birthday as Month day "January 11". Google Chrome is a trademark of Google LLC. 1 How to calculate age using a formula. The best spent money on software I've ever spent! Hello, In the Formula Helper dialog, choose Calculate age based on birthday in Choose a formula section, then select the cell contains birth date into Date textbox, click Ok. 3. How to calculate years between two dates in Excel. using this formula will make their age 100+.. is there any modification to the formula for the above problem? Excel Age Calculation examples (.xlsx file) The YEARFRAC() method worked very well with the exception for people where today was their birthday. 6. 5 Company B 10/1/2009 1/31/2012 How do you know on what date he completes his 50 years of age? I would love to seek your kind support and help that will resolve my issue. In excel we can calculate the age of a person if we know the person’s date of birth and the current date. This also looks for 3 arguments: the start date, the end date, and optional holidays. Fill the following formula in range B1:B1001: 1 Million & other is Rs. To display the number of complete years, use the INT function to round a decimal down to the nearest integer: Drawbacks: Using this age formula in Excel produces pretty accurate results, but not flawless. Calculate the age of a person on a specific date. Hello! I have calculated my Age. Calculate age on a specific or future date with formula. If i entered birthday in cell b2 i would like to know how to get number in months There is no need to write a formula for each cell. On the Insert menu, click Module. 2 Million how to add in sum formula kindly send me on gmail address. If you like the tools and decide to get a license, don't miss this special offer for our blog readers. Since age is the difference in years between two dates (a birth date and some other date), the YRDIF function has been used to compute ages in this way: age = INT(YRDIF(birth-date, ending-date,'ACTUAL')); In this implementation, YRDIF first determines the actual number of days between two dates. 2. In this example, the start date is in cell D17, and the end date is in E17. How do you normally figure out someone's age? I have tried converting it to several formats. I would use NOW() if I was looking for a time. Learn more about date & time functions >. So, it looks like Excel changes a year for to the same as in and calculates the difference in days. Find out a date when a person attains N years of age. Anyone who works with Excel is sure to find their work made easier. This function makes calculating any kind of date comparisons a breeze. Convert birthdate to age with the INT function. For calculating the number of days since the date of birth, you may use the following ways. Clearly, using DATEDIFF to calculate the difference between dates in years isn't accurate enough for something as potentially sensitive as age.In that case we need a different approach. I Found Below Formula : Just write it for the topmost cell (row 3 in your case), and then drag it down to copy the formula to other cells: Thank you. Hello! 4 Company C 2/13/2012 4/24/2012 Start date = 3/29/2017 11:47:29 AM To highlight ages equal to or greater than 18: =$C2>=18. I am trying to calculate age in excel 2016 using this formula, =IF(ISBLANK(C2), " ",DATEDIF(C2,NOW(), "y")), When I check the age of each field is a year lower for example. =YEAR(TODAY())-A2. A B C 1 COMPANY FROM TO The DATEDIF function has three arguments. To calculate the number of years between two dates, you can use the YEARFRAC function, which will return a decimal number representing the fraction of a year between two dates. the number of whole days between two dates. in sheet 1 im using this formula: =INT((TODAY()-B2)/365... where B2 is the cell where the date of birth is.....but the source of the date of birth in my age calculator is from different sheet, in sheet 2, C2 what will be the formula? THANKS To overcome this, Power Query has a solution that can solve this problem within a fraction of second. Thanks, =DATEDIF(D3, E3, "y") You will learn a handful of formulas to calculate age as a number of complete years, get exact age in years, months and days at today's date or a particular date. The children date of birth is on sheet 1 (called Info) in cell C3 Iâm sorry but your task is not entirely clear to me. Even I used simple age calculation formula using INT function but I couldn't get result in decimal numbers. Please describe your problem in more detail. It takes in a start date and an end date. If there's Any trick to find it out then Please tell us. This is very useful for me. I used a translator. ( Y,M,D,MD,YM,YD) in double-quotes. How can I transform the formula to give the patient's age in years when they are 1 yr and older, and in months when they are 1 to 11 months old? As far as I know there is no way to "fix" this other than installing the English locale of Office. To calculate the age of a person in Excel, use DATEDIF and TODAY. Now there are two formulas you can use to calculate the age in Google Sheets in years (i.e., to get the total number of years that have elapsed between the two given dates). But what if your formula displays age in years and months, or in years, months and days? To learn the details, I invite you to download this Excel Age Calculator and investigate the formulas in cells B9:B11. Note: fill in "ym" for the third argument to ignore years and get the number of months between two dates. If you'd rather not reinvent the wheel, you can use the age calculator created by our Excel professionals. Birthdate is cell a1 (dd.mm.yyyy hh:mm:ss), todays-date is cell b1 (dd.mm.yyyy hh:mm:ss). Amazing blog. Now I want more to calculate in hours, minute and seconds so that it would be 18 years 11 months 13 days 2 hours 56 minute 33seconds etc. Hello! Next Chapter: Text Functions, Calculate Age • © 2010-2021
If you want to know someone's age at a certain date, use the DATEDIF age formula discussed above, but replace the TODAY() function in the 2nd argument with the specific date. Working in an international environment I have tried to share date functions with references to dates using mm dd yy etc. 2) As you can see in layout file, I have used fixed value for "Start Date","End Date" to calculate Date Difference and fixed value for "Birth Date" to calculate Age. And thank you so much for pointing this out! I like it its very helpfull and many options for calculate DOB Thanks. 4/12 Completed! You are assigned five tasks. Learn how to calculate the amount of time between two dates with precision in Excel. The DATEDIF function below calculates the age of a person. Can you help me with the formula (Indirect function) in excel to my email ID, thanks. What is wrong? So, here's an improved YEARFRAC formula to calculate age in Excel: One more way to convert date of birth to age in Excel is using the DATEDIF function: This function can return the difference between two dates in various time units such as years, months and days, depending on the value you supply in the unit argument: Since we aim to calculate age in years, we are using the "y" unit: In this example, the DOB is in cell B2, and you reference this cell in your age formula: No additional rounding function is needed in this case because a DATEDIF formula with the "y" unit calculates the number of full years: As you have just seen, calculating age as the number of full years that the person has lived is easy, but it is not always sufficient. I am using Excel 2007 (don't know if that matters, but) . To calculate the number of years between two dates, you can use the YEARFRAC function, which will return a decimal number representing the fraction of a year between two dates.In the example shown, the formula in D6 is: = YEARFRAC (B6, C6) So how do you calculate Birthday when you only have Birth Month and Day and age and not birth year, Hello Marc! To create rules based on the above formulas, select the cells or entire rows that you want to highlight, go to the Home tab > Styles group, and click Conditional Formatting > New Rule… > Use a formula to determine which cells to format. I have not been able to replicate your result. Select a blank cell to output the age. But if I simply added 1 to TODAY(), then it worked as expected. Choose whether to calculate age in days, months, years, or exact age. Overall, subtracting the birth date from the current date works great in normal life, but is not the ideal approach in Excel. The values that meet your condition are marked with YES in column B. Could you please describe it in more detail? To calculate a person’s age using the DATEDIF function, you can enter a formula like this: =DATEDIF ("5/16/1972",TODAY (),"y") You can, of course, reference a cell that contains a date: =DATEDIF (B4,TODAY (),"y") The DATEDIF function calculates the number of days, months, or years between two dates. Steps to Extract Age Using Date With Power Query. For example, if you type 5/28/19, Excel assumes the date is May 28, 2019. So please help me in this. As I'm also using the binarytranslator tools to calculate anyone's age. For me to be able to help you better, please describe your task in more detail. 1, 10, 11, 12...2, 20, 21 etc. It's displaying correctly but I don't know where to put the code that can display "blank" if the A2 cell is no data. To calculate age from date of birth we will use TODAY() function along with the INT function in Excel 2016.. TODAY function in Excel is used to generate today’s date in a cell. I used your formula =DATEDIF(B2, TODAY(), "Y") but I got #VALUE! But let's be traditional, and learn how to calculate age from DOB in years first. Basis is an optional argument that defines the day count basis to use. Hello Svetlana, Calculate Age in Excel for Dates Prior to 1900. A loootttttt of thank you for this tutorial. If you'd like to get rid of zero units like "0 days", select the Do not show zero units check box: If you are curious to test this age calculator as well as to discover 60 more time-saving add-ins for Excel, you are welcome to download a trial version of our Ultimate Suite.